So I've been noticing a few players who are quite new to the RP Events. This thread is designed to help those who might have future questions for it later, and to get a broad idea of what they could possibly expect.
King Azreth has graciously stepped in from his busy schedule to help me in this endeavor.
Now without further adieu, let's get on with a short explanation.
arrow Step 1 - Sign up for the event. You guys have been pretty good about doing this so far. Remember, when you sign up, fill out the form as correctly as possible. You have three times (all in Eastern Standard Time Zone - or EST) to choose from - 1 pm, 6pm, and 10 pm. If you are unsure of which times will work for you, sign up for all three, but remember - you may only participate at one time. I usually open sign up threads the Monday after an event and close sign up threads at 12 pm the day of the event. Sometimes, sign ups are not mandatory, but signing up helps me in creating obstacles and making the games fair and fun for everyone participating. Also, I cannot stress this enough - be on time! If you show up to an event 10 minutes late, your horse will automatically be at a disadvantage and you wouldn't want that. However, I will give special rounds under extremely special circumstances. I'm not completely heartless and I'm willing to work with you as long as you are willing to work with me.
arrow Step 2 - Participate. Now this one I'm going to have to break down.
>>>>On the day of the event, I will quote you at least 20 to 30 minutes before your time is supposed to begin. That way, it'll give players time to check their messages and what not. I will only quote you once so make sure you keep a tab open for the RP Event.
>>>>After I quote you, post to let me know you are ready. When you post, make sure you include an image of your Azrein (no URLs please) as well as Stats underneath them and some sort of slogan ("Nailiah is willing and ready to go!"). The game will begin after all players are accounted for OR when time says it should start.
I think the rest will be mostly self explanatory. I will post what is required of your Azrein (an obstacle) each time until a winner is chosen. If there is only one person playing, I reserve the right to deem them the winner if I see fit. No sense in having them do all that work only to get the 2% prize.
RP Events can take anywhere from an hour to two and a half hours long so make sure you have the time to sit down and do so.
